Requirements for Admission into FUPRE
Applicant would need to satisfy the following general requirements:
(a) Admissions shall be through the Joint Admissions and Matriculations Board (JAMB);

(b) For admission to 100 level, candidates must possess five (5) credit passes at Senior Secondary School Certificate Examination (SSSCE) or equivalent in relevant subjects in only one sittings; and obtain a minimum of 200 points in University Matriculation Examination.

(c) All candidates who score above 200 UME and choose FUPRE as either first or second choice are further invited to a Post University Matriculation Examination (PUME) of the Federal University of Petroleum Resources Effurun.

(d) FUPRE Post University Matriculation Examination (PUME) is a two stage assessment process. They are;
i) Written: - Computer base examination at designated centre
ii) Oral :- Oral interview at the University premises.

What FUPRE look out for
Admissions staff at the FUPRE look for the following information on the PUME form:

1. Academic ability and potential as shown by your SSSCE,GCSE or NECO results (where available
2. The context of your achievement
3. Strong reasons for choosing the course, and motivation to study a particular discipline
4. Extra-curricular activities, achievements and responsibilities
5. The personal statement and reference
6. Additional evidence of achievement, motivation and potential as gathered through interview or assessment of written materials
